Acetylenic Phosphines Bridging Two Cluster Units: Molecular Structure of {Ru3(µ-H)(µ3-C2But )(CO)8}2(µ-dppa)[dppa =C2(PPh2)2]

Michael I. Bruce, Paul A. Humphrey, Brian W. Skelton and Allan H. White

Australian Journal of Chemistry 50(6) 535 - 538
Published: 1997

Abstract

The syntheses of two complexes consisting of two Ru3(µ-H)(µ3-C2But)(CO)8 clusters bridged by acetylenic ditertiary phosphines, C2(PR2)2 [R = Ph (3), Bun (4)], are described. The molecular structure of (3) confirms that substitution of the cluster at the ruthenium which is σ bonded to the acetylide has occurred. The structural parameters closely resemble those of Ru3(µ−H)(µ3-C2But)(CO)8(L) [L = CO, PPh2(OEt)].
